Wrt your 1st question:
I confirm you get information on both ways (Reportable REST API and OSLC).
You could check this post for technical details on how to operate on RQM artefacts on both ways: http://sleroyblog.wordpress.com/2013/04/09/querying-rqm-40-through-oslc-and-rest-api/
Now back to your second question (RQM REST APIs vs OSLC QM):
Check https://jazz.net/wiki/bin/view/Main/RqmOslcQmV2Api
- It will give you a clear idea of what's in OSLC than is not available in RQM REST APIs .
- Note also you'll find the following "Tip: In general, use the OSLC QM V2 API unless requiring unsupported resources."
